On Wednesday 21 June 2006 12:20, Bill Moran wrote:
> In response to Richard Collyer <richard@firebadger.net>:
> > Hello,
> >
> > I'm moving from mod_php5 to php5 and need to remove php5-extensions in
> > order for pkg remove to work.
> >
> > What is the easiest way to do this...can I just cd /php5-exten.. dir and
> > make deinstall or will i have to go through them all one by one (I have
> > a lot installed).
>
> The pkg_cutleaves port will simplify things for you.

i did something similar recently, and 'pkg_delete -r php5-extensions'  will 
make them all go *poof*.
